Step 2
Perform zero correction
To achieve optimum accuracy for low current measurements, it is recommended that you zero
correct the electrometer. To do so, select the 20pA range (which is the lowest range) and press
the ZCOR key until the "ZZ" message is displayed. See Section 2 for details on zero correction.

WARNING
A safety shield is required whenever a hazardous voltage (>30V) is present
on the noise shield. This can occur when the test circuit is floated above
earth ground at a hazardous voltage level (see "Floating Measurements" in
Section 2). Connections for the safety shield are shown in Figure 4-1. The
metal safety shield must completely surround the noise shield or foating test
circuit, and it must be connected to safety earth ground using #18 AWG or
larger wire.
